label标签中的for属性
时间: 2024-05-06 20:15:43 浏览: 16
for属性是HTML中<label>标签的一个属性,用于指定与该标签相关联的表单元素的ID。当用户单击<label>标签时,浏览器就会自动将光标移动到与该标签相关联的表单元素上,从而方便用户操作。使用for属性的好处是,即使用户单击<label>标签的文本部分,也会自动聚焦到与之相关联的表单元素上。例如:
```
<label for="username">用户名:</label>
<input type="text" id="username" name="username">
```
上面的代码中,label标签的for属性值为"username",与下面的input元素的id属性值相同,表示这两个元素相关联。当用户单击"用户名"这个文本时,光标会自动聚焦到对应的文本框中,方便用户输入信息。
相关问题
html中label标签
label标签用于为表单元素提供标签文本。它通常与input元素配合使用,以提高表单的可用性和可访问性。
示例代码:
```html
<label for="username">用户名:</label>
<input type="text" id="username" name="username">
<label for="password">密码:</label>
<input type="password" id="password" name="password">
```
在上面的示例中,label标签用于描述输入框的用途。通过将label的for属性与对应的input元素的id属性进行关联,当用户点击label时,浏览器会自动将焦点定位到相应的input元素。这样可以增加表单的可用性,尤其是对于视力受损的用户。
另外,使用label标签还可以通过屏幕阅读器等辅助技术来提供更好的可访问性。屏幕阅读器可以读取label标签的文本,并将其与对应的表单元素关联起来,使得用户可以更容易地理解表单的用途和操作方法。
总结:label标签在HTML中是一个很有用的元素,它可以提高表单的可用性和可访问性。通过与input元素配合使用,可以为用户提供更好的交互体验。
idea label for 属性爆红
这个问题需要更具体的上下文才能回答得更准确。不过通常情况下,"属性爆红"是指在代码编辑器中使用一个未定义的属性,导致编辑器将该属性标记为错误并以红色或其他醒目的方式进行提示。在 IntelliJ IDEA 中,可以使用 "Unresolved property" 或 "Unknown property" 标签来表示这种情况。